This course builds the financial acumen every manager needs to make confident, informed business decisions.

You’ll cover core finance and accounting concepts, learn to interpret financial statements, and use practical tools (including ratio analysis and corporate finance techniques) to evaluate performance and risk.

Throughout the course, you’ll develop a future action plan grounded in your real workplace challenges—so the learning doesn’t stay theoretical.

In this course, you’ll:

  • Build confidence in interpreting financial statements and key metrics.
  • Use practical tools to evaluate performance and assess risk.
  • Strengthen your ability to contribute to financial conversations and decisions.
  • Create an action plan you can apply directly in your role.

What you will study

  • Key financial concepts managers need
  • Accounting methods and how they affect reporting
  • Interpreting financial statements with clarity
  • Practical tools and ratio analysis
  • Corporate finance techniques for better decisions
  • Building a future action plan for financial management in your context

How you will learn

Online, self-paced. Onboarding sequence first, then a mix of resources, eLearning modules and video content—plus practical activities to apply learning in your own context.

Assessment: No formal assessments. Learning is consolidated through reflective and interactive activities.
